What Does WYN Mean?
At its core, WYN means “What You Need?”, and it’s typically used in quick messaging to ask someone what they require or expect. It reflects the speed-focused nature of online communication, where abbreviations are used to save time while keeping interactions friendly.
Examples in Different Contexts:
| Context | Example | Meaning |
| Chat / Texting | “I’m free this afternoon. WYN?” | “What do you need?” |
| Social Media | Comment on a post: “WYN?” | Asking what support or input the poster wants |
| Gaming | “I have extra gear. WYN?” | “Which items do you need?” |
| Professional Messaging | “WYN from me before the meeting?” | “What do you require from me?” |

Similar Terms & Alternatives
Several text abbreviations are often used interchangeably or alongside WYN in digital messaging:
- WYD (What You Doing?) – Focuses on activity rather than needs.
- WYA (Where You At?) – Asks location instead of requirements.
- HMU (Hit Me Up) – Invites contact or interaction, similar in casual tone.
- IDK (I Don’t Know) – Shows uncertainty; sometimes used in combination with WYN for clarification.

Differences from Similar Words
While WYN shares similarities with other acronyms, it differs in purpose:
| Term | Meaning | Difference from WYN |
| WYD | What You Doing? | Asks about activity, not needs. |
| WYA | Where You At? | Asks about location, not assistance. |
| HMU | Hit Me Up | Invites interaction, less about specific needs. |
| IDK | I Don’t Know | Shows uncertainty, does not prompt for information. |
Recognizing these differences ensures accurate interpretation and response, avoiding miscommunication in digital conversations.
